dc.description.abstract | Presently, the application of nitrogen as an alloying and modifying element in alloys is extending. High nitrogen steels (HNS) are finding increased application in many different branches of industry. In the present study we propose a new approach to the problem of calculating the nitrogen solubility in HNS and alloys, obtained under high pressures, by generalising the widely used Wagner thermodynamic model, The interaction parameters of the generalised Wagner model are determined with respect to a more relevant reference state for the solvent: instead of pure solvent we consider a given grade of a complex alloy as a reference state. | en_US |
